/**
|
||||
* Interruptible variant of vlc_sem_wait().
|
||||
*
|
||||
* Waits on a semaphore like vlc_sem_wait(). If the calling thread has an
|
||||
* interruption context (as set by vlc_interrupt_set()), and another thread
|
||||
* invokes vlc_interrupt_raise() on that context, the semaphore is incremented.
|
||||
*
|
||||
* @warning The calling thread should be the only thread ever to wait on the
|
||||
* specified semaphore. Otherwise, interruptions may not be delivered
|
||||
* accurately (the wrong thread may be woken up).
|
||||
*
|
||||
* @note This function is (always) a cancellation point.
|
||||
*
|
||||
* @return EINTR if the semaphore was incremented due to an interruption,
|
||||
* otherwise zero.
|
||||
*/
|
||||
VLC_API int vlc_sem_wait_i11e(vlc_sem_t *);
|
||||
|
||||
/**
|
||||
* Interruptible variant of mwait().
|
||||
*
|
||||
* Waits for a specified timestamp or, if the calling thread has an
|
||||
* interruption context, an interruption.
|
||||
*
|
||||
* @return EINTR if an interruption occurred, otherwise 0 once the timestamp is
|
||||
* reached.
|
||||
*/
|
||||
VLC_API int vlc_mwait_i11e(mtime_t);
|
||||
|
||||
/**
|
||||
* Interruptible variant of msleep().
|
||||
*
|
||||
* Waits for a specified timeout duration or, if the calling thread has an
|
||||
* interruption context, an interruption.
|
||||
*
|
||||
* @param delay timeout value (in microseconds)
|
||||
*
|
||||
* @return EINTR if an interruption occurred, otherwise 0 once the timeout
|
||||
* expired.
|
||||
*/
|
||||
static inline int vlc_msleep_i11e(mtime_t delay)
|
||||
{
|
||||
return vlc_mwait_i11e(mdate() + delay);
|
||||
}
|
||||
|
||||
/**
|
||||
* Interruptible variant of poll().
|
||||
*
|
||||
* Waits for file descriptors I/O events, a timeout, a signal or a VLC I/O
|
||||
* interruption. Except for VLC I/O interruptions, this function behaves
|
||||
* just like the standard poll().
|
||||
*
|
||||
* @note This function is always a cancellation point (as poll()).
|
||||
* @see poll() manual page
|
||||
*
|
||||
* @param fds table of events to wait for
|
||||
* @param nfds number of entries in the table
|
||||
* @param timeout time to wait in milliseconds or -1 for infinite
|
||||
*
|
||||
* @return A strictly positive result represent the number of pending events.
|
||||
* 0 is returned if the time-out is reached without events.
|
||||
* -1 is returned if a VLC I/O interrupt occurs (and errno is set to EINTR)
|
||||
* or if an error occurs.
|
||||
*/
|
||||
VLC_API int vlc_poll_i11e(struct pollfd *, unsigned, int);

/**
|
||||
* Registers a custom interrupt handler.
|
||||
*
|
||||
* Registers a custom callback as interrupt handler for the calling thread.
|
||||
* The callback must be unregistered with vlc_interrupt_unregister() before
|
||||
* thread termination and before any further callback registration.
|
||||
*
|
||||
* If the calling thread has no interruption context, this function has no
|
||||
* effects.
|
||||
*/
|
||||
VLC_API void vlc_interrupt_register(void (*cb)(void *), void *opaque);

/**
|
||||
* Sets the interruption context for the calling thread.
|
||||
* @param newctx the interruption context to attach or NULL for none
|
||||
* @return the previous interruption context or NULL if none
|
||||
*
|
||||
* @note This function is not a cancellation point.
|
||||
* @warning A context can be attached to no more than one thread at a time.
|
||||
*/
|
||||
VLC_API vlc_interrupt_t *vlc_interrupt_set(vlc_interrupt_t *);
|
||||
|
||||
/**
|
||||
* Raises an interruption through a specified context.
|
||||
*
|
||||
* This is used to asynchronously wake a thread up while it is waiting on some
|
||||
* other events (typically I/O events).
|
||||
*
|
||||
* @note This function is thread-safe.
|
||||
* @note This function is not a cancellation point.
|
||||
*/
|
||||
VLC_API void vlc_interrupt_raise(vlc_interrupt_t *);
|
||||
|
||||
/**
|
||||
* Marks the interruption context as "killed".
|
||||
*
|
||||
* This is not reversible.
|
||||
*/
|
||||
VLC_API void vlc_interrupt_kill(vlc_interrupt_t *);
|
||||
|
||||
/**
|
||||
* Checks if the interruption context was "killed".
|
||||
*
|
||||
* Indicates whether the interruption context of the calling thread (if any)
|
||||
* was killed with vlc_interrupt_kill().
|
||||
*/
|
||||
VLC_API bool vlc_killed(void) VLC_USED;
|
||||
|
||||
/**
|
||||
* Enables forwarding of interruption.
|
||||
*
|
||||
* If an interruption is raised through the context of the calling thread,
|
||||
* it will be forwarded to the specified other context. This is used to cross
|
||||
* thread boundaries.
|
||||
*
|
||||
* If the calling thread has no interrupt context, this function does nothing.
|
||||
*
|
||||
* @param to context to forward to
|
||||
*/
|
||||
VLC_API void vlc_interrupt_forward_start(vlc_interrupt_t *to,
|
||||
void *data[2]);
|
||||
|
||||
/**
|
||||
* Undoes vlc_interrupt_forward_start().
|
||||
*
|
||||
* This function must be called after each successful call to
|
||||
* vlc_interrupt_forward_start() before any other interruptible call is made
|
||||
* in the same thread.
|
||||
*
|
||||
* If an interruption was raised against the context of the calling thread
|
||||
* (after the previous call to vlc_interrupt_forward_start()), it is dequeued.
|
||||
*
|
||||
* If the calling thread has no interrupt context, this function does nothing
|
||||
* and returns zero.
|
||||
*
|
||||
* @return 0 if no interrupt was raised, EINTR if an interrupt was raised
|
||||
*/
|
||||
VLC_API int vlc_interrupt_forward_stop(void *const data[2]);
